The GUHRING 9055100085000 is a solid carbide screw machine length drill bit designed for high-performance drilling in demanding production environments. Built to DIN 6537 K standards, it features a 140-degree split point (SU type) with web thinning for reduced thrust and improved chip evacuation. The 8.50mm (0.3346 inches) diameter bit runs a 2-flute regular spiral configuration with coolant-through capability, making it well-suited for high-cycle machining operations where heat management is critical. Machinists and tooling professionals working in precision manufacturing and job shop environments rely on this series for consistent hole quality in ferrous materials.
This drill bit is rated for primary use in cast iron and steel workpieces. The screw machine length geometry — shorter overall length relative to standard jobber drills — provides added rigidity and reduced deflection in CNC machining centers, turret lathes, and screw machine applications. The straight-cylindrical shank diameter of 10.00mm seats securely in standard drill chucks and collet holders. The 3xD flute-to-diameter ratio supports drilling depths up to 44.00mm, keeping chip flow controlled through the full cut.

Installation should be performed by a qualified machinist or tooling technician familiar with carbide cutting tools. Ensure the machine spindle and toolholder are free of chips and runout before seating the shank. Carbide tooling is brittle — avoid side loads, interrupted cuts without proper parameters, and contact with hardened surfaces during handling. Verify coolant-through passages are clear and system pressure is appropriate for the application before beginning the cut.
